Geneva Airport (GVA)

Located approximately 4 kilometers from the city center of Geneva, easily accessible via public transport and close to Lake Geneva.

Lisbon Humberto Delgado Airport (LIS)

Situated about 7 kilometers northeast of Lisbon city center, easily linked by metro and public transport.

Travel Tips

  • ⛰ Embrace the Local Culture

    Before you board your flight from Geneva to Lisbon, take some time to research and appreciate Portuguese customs. Knowing basic greetings in Portuguese, such as 'Bom dia' (Good morning) and 'Obrigado' (Thank you), can enhance your interactions upon arrival.

  • 📍 Pack for Varied Weather

    Consider the climate differences between Geneva and Lisbon. While Geneva can be cooler, Lisbon has a Mediterranean climate. Pack layers and be sure to include lightweight clothing for warmer temperatures, along with a light jacket, especially if your trip spans early spring or autumn.

  • 🚍 Enjoy Onboard Delicacies

    Airlines on this route often serve Portuguese snacks like 'Pastéis de Nata' (custard tarts) or 'Bacalhau' (codfish). If available, don’t miss the chance to enjoy a taste of Portugal even before you land.

  • 🎭 Stay Connected with Wi-Fi Options

    Many airlines offer in-flight Wi-Fi on flights from Geneva to Lisbon. Consider purchasing access to stay connected and plan your itinerary upon arrival. Download essential travel apps or even maps of Lisbon to assist you in navigation.

  • 🏛 Being Mindful of Time Zones

    Lisbon is one hour behind Geneva. Make sure to adjust your watch or phone as soon as you board the flight to avoid being caught off guard upon arrival. This helps you adapt to the local time for smoother travel plans.
